10-06-2020 Heard learned counsel for the parties through video conferencing.

The petitioner seeks bail in Kudhani P.S. Case No. 668 of 2019 registered for the offence under Sections 414, 467, 468, 471 & 34 of the Indian Penal Code and Sections 30(a), 38(1) and 41(1) of the Bihar Prohibition and Excise Act, 2016. As per prosecution case, 2538 litres of foreign liquor was recovered from a truck, bearing registration no. RJ11GA1976, as also 1314 litres of illicit foreign liquor was recovered from a pick-up van, bearing registration no. BR33J-9702. It is alleged that petitioner and others have brought aforesaid liquor from Haryana.

It is submitted on behalf of petitioner that petitioner has falsely been implicated in this case and nothing has been

Patna High Court CR. MISC. No.2034 of 2020(3) dt.10-06-2020 2/2 recovered from his conscious possession. It is further submitted that petitioner is neither owner nor driver of any of the seized vehicles. Petitioner has got no concern with the aforesaid liquor and only on suspicion, he has been made accused. Section 100 Cr.P.C. has not been followed with respect to search and seizure. Petitioner has got clean antecedent, as stated in paragraph - 3 of the petition.

Considering the aforesaid facts and circumstances, the bail application is allowed.

Let the above-named petitioner be enlarged on bail on furnishing bail bonds of Rs. 10,000/- (ten th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ned Special Judge, Excise Act, Muzaffarpur in connection with Kudhani P.S. Case No. 668 of 2019, subject to condition as laid down under Section 438(2) of the Cr.P.C.
